100 mg nicotine 125ml bottle 75%pg 25%vg I am having a hard time figuring out how to make 6mg liquid

Disclaimer: Be very careful when working with concentrated nicotine base! Look for tips in the DIY forum.

100mg nic base is easy to work with when it comes to nic levels. If you want to make 6mg juice, just make sure that 6% of your total liquid volume is nic base. If you want 12mg, use 12% volume. Etc.

Example: You're making a 30ml bottle of DIY juice and you want it to have 6mg nicotine. 6% of 30ml is 1.8ml (30 × .06 = 1.8). So add 1.8ml nic base, and 28.2ml of the rest (vg/pg/flavor at whatever ratio you prefer).

Just figure out how much VG you want to end up with, and where it could possibly come from - in your case, nic base, and pure VG.

If you want 6mg of a 50/50 PG/VG mix with 20% flavorings, 10 ml, you want:

0.6ml nic base (0.15ml VG)
2ml total flavorings (0 ml VG)

So you've got the important stuff, and now it's just time bring it up to 10ml. You've only got 0.15ml VG, so you need 4.85 ml VG, bringing your volume up to 7.45ml. That leaves 2.55ml PG, and you're done!

for a 125 ml bottle using 100 mg strength nic base.
6% nic base.
20 % flavoring.
49 % PG
25 % VG.
strength =0.6 % nic or 6 mg nic per ml.
the % of flavoring varies per recipe and flavoring usually
come in different bases.
these figures assume the flavor and nic are PG based
